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

The invention relates to novel conjugated polymers containing repeating units comprising a halogenated benzene ring, a silolobithiophene moiety, and a benzofused heteroaromatic moiety, to methods for their preparation and educts or intermediates used therein, to polymer blends, mixtures and formulations containing them, to the use of the polymers, polymer blends, mixtures and formulations as organic semiconductors in organic electronic (OE) devices, especially in organic photovoltaic (OPV) devices and organic photodetectors (OPD), and to OE, OPV and OPD devices comprising these polymers, polymer blends, mixtures or formulations.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. A polymer comprising: at least one unit of formula I  wherein A is an optionally substituted, benzofused heteroaryl moiety comprising 1-6 heteroatoms selected from the group consisting of N, O, S, P, Si, Se, As, Te, and Ge, wherein the benzofused heteroaryl moiety is selected from the group consisting of formula B1a, formula B1b, formula B1c, formula B2a, formula B2b, and formula B3a,  R 1 and R 2 are the same or different, and are independently selected from H or halogen, R 3 , R 4 , R 5 , R 6 , R 7 are the same or different, and are independently selected from H, halogen, C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ties, in which one or more non-adjacent CH 2 groups are optionally replaced by —O—, —S—, —C(O)—, —C(S)—, —C(O)—O—, —O—C(O)—, —NR 0 —, —SiR 0 R 00 —, —CF 2 —, —CHR 0 ═CR 00 —, —CY 1 ═CY 2 — or —C≡C— so that O and/or S atoms are not linked directly to one another, and one or more H atoms are optionally replaced by F, Cl, Br, I or CN, or aryl, heteroaryl, aryloxy or heteroaryloxy with 4 to 20 ring atoms that are optionally substituted by halogen or substituted or unsubstituted C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ties, Y 1 and Y 2 are the same or different, and are independently selected from H, F, Cl or CN, R 0 and R 00 are the same or different, and are independently selected from H or optionally substituted C 1 -C 40 carbyl or hydrocarbyl moieties. 2. The polymer according to claim 1 , wherein A is a moiety selected from the group consisting of formula B1a, formula B2b and formula B3a. 3. The polymer according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one unit of formula I is selected from the group consisting of formula Ia, formula Ib, formula Ic, formula Id, formula Ie, formula If, formula Ig, formula Ih, formula Ii, formula Ij, formula Ik, formula Il, formula Im, formula In, formula Io, formula Ip, formula Iq, and formula Ir, wherein R 3 , R 5 and R 6 are the same or different, and are independently selected from H, halogen, C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ties, in which one or more non-adjacent CH 2 groups are optionally replaced by —O—, —S—, —C(O)—, —C(S)—, —C(O)—O—, —O—C(O)—, —NR 0 —, —SiR 0 R 00 —, —CF 2 —, —CHR 0 ═CR 00 —, —CY 1 ═CY 2 — or —C≡C— so that O and/or S atoms are not linked directly to one another, and one or more H atoms are optionally replaced by F, Cl, Br, I or CN, or aryl, heteroaryl, aryloxy or heteroaryloxy with 4 to 20 ring atoms that are optionally substituted by halogen or substituted or unsubstituted C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ties. 4. The polymer according to claim 1 of formula II wherein A is at least one unit selected from the group consisting of formula I, formula Ia, formula Ib, formula Ic, formula Id, formula Ie, formula If, formula Ig, formula Ih, formula Ii, formula Ij, formula Ik, formula Il, formula Im, formula In, formula Io, formula Ip, formula Iq, and formula Ir, B is at least one unit that is different from A and is selected from the group consisting of formula I, formula Ia, formula Ib, formula Ic, formula Id, formula Ie, formula If, formula Ig, formula Ih, formula Ii, formula Ij, formula Ik, formula Il, formula Im, formula In, formula Io, formula Ip, formula Iq, and formula Ir, wherein R 3 , R 5 and R 6 are the same or different, and are independently selected from H, halogen, C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ties, in which one or more non-adjacent CH 2 groups are optionally replaced by —O—, —S—, —C(O)—, —C(S)—, —C(O)—O—, —O—C(O)—, —NR 0 —, —SiR 0 R 00 —, —CF 2 —, —CHR 0 ═CR 00 —, —CY 1 ═CY 2 — or —C≡C— so that O and/or S atoms are not linked directly to one another, and one or more H atoms are optionally replaced by F, Cl, Br, I or CN, or aryl, heteroaryl, aryloxy or heteroaryloxy with 4 to 20 ring atoms that are optionally substituted by halogen or substituted or unsubstituted C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ties; x is >0 and ≦1, Y is ≧0 and <1, x+y is 1, and n is an integer >1. 5. The polymer according to claim 4 selected from the group consisting of formula IIa, formula IIb, formula IIc, formula IId, formula IIe, formula IIf, formula IIg, formula IIh, formula IIi, formula Ilk, formula IIm, formula IIn, formula IIo, formula IIp, formula IIq, and formula IIr, wherein R 3 , R 5 and R 6 are the same or different, and are independently selected from H, halogen, C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ties, in which one or more non-adjacent CH 2 groups are optionally replaced by —O—, —S—, —C(O)—, —C(S)—, —C(O)—O—, —O—C(O)—, —NR 0 —, —SiR 0 R 00 —, —CF 2 —, —CHR 0 ═CR 00 —, —CY 1 ═CY 2 — or —C≡C— so that O and/or S atoms are not linked directly to one another, and one or more H atoms are optionally replaced by F, Cl, Br, I or CN, or aryl, heteroaryl, aryloxy or heteroaryloxy with 4 to 20 ring atoms that are optionally substituted by halogen or substituted or unsubstituted C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ties, n is an integer >1, 0<x<1 and 0<y<1. 6. A polymer of formula III R 8 -chain-R 9   III wherein “chain” is the polymer of claim 4 , R 8 and R 9 are the same or different, and are selected independently from the group consisting of H, halogen, C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ties, in which one or more non-adjacent CH 2 groups are optionally replaced by —O—, —S—, —C(O)—, —C(S)—, —C(O)—O—, —O—C(O)—, —NR 0 —, —SiR 0 R 00 —, —CF 2 —, —CHR 0 ═CR 00 —, —CY 1 ═CY 2 — or —C≡C— so that O and/or S atoms are not linked directly to one another, and one or more H atoms are optionally replaced by F, Cl, Br, I or CN, or aryl, heteroaryl, aryloxy or heteroaryloxy with 4 to 20 ring atoms that are optionally substituted by halogen or substituted or unsubstituted C 1 -C 30 straight-chain, branched or cyclic alkyl moieties, or are selected independently from the group consisting of H, F, Br, Cl, I, —CH 2 Cl, —CHO, —CR a ═CR b 2 , —SiR a R b R c , —SiR a X a X b , —SiR a R b X a , —SnR a R b R c , —BR a R b , —B(OR a )(OR b ), —B(OH) 2 , —O—SO 2 —R a , —C≡CH, —C≡—SiR a 3 , —ZnX a or an endcap group, X a and X b are halogen, R a , R b and R c are the same or different, and are selected independently from the group consisting of H or optionally substituted C 1 -C 40 carbyl or hydrocarbyl moieties, and wherein two of R a , R b and R c may also form a ring together with the hetero atom to which they are attached. 7.
